Exquisite Freehold Land for Sale in Bangkok's Desirable Sam Sen Nok District

Presenting a luxurious 400sqm land space located in the affluent Sam Sen Nok area of Huai Khwang, Bangkok, this property offers a freehold ownership that ensures long-term value and security. Boasting a sale price of 24,000,000 THB, this premium piece of land is nestled within a coveted residential neighborhood, providing an exceptional canvas for investors to develop high-end residential or commercial projects.

Investors will appreciate the vicinity's wealth of conveniences, including close proximity to the MRT Huai Khwang and Sutthisan stations, enhancing the accessibility and desirability for potential developments. Notable amenities such as The Street Ratchada, Fortune Town, Central Plaza Rama 9, and Central Plaza Ladprao are merely a short distance away, offering superior retail and lifestyle venues.

Strategically located, the property ensures seamlless connectivity to major roads like Ratchadaphisek and Ladprao. A Free transfer fee promotion adds an attractive incentive to secure this investment.

Positives
Sam Sen Nok has good transport connections making it easy to get around Bangkok without much hassle. The area offers a nice variety of food choices which I know is important if you enjoy discovering new places to eat. Streets tend to feel safe, especially in the evenings, and the general atmosphere blends city convenience with a bit of local character.
Negatives
Traffic can get quite heavy and the pollution level doesn’t always help, so the air quality is something to keep in mind if you’re sensitive. It can also be quite noisy at times with the city’s buzz, which might not suit everyone, especially if you're used to more tranquility.

How can I make profit from buying a condo in Bangkok?

user image
ThaiEstate
1 year ago
Helpful

Hello Ye... This ultra-luxury property in Bangkok offers strong investment potential through both capital appreciation and rental income. Historically, prime Bangkok real estate has appreciated by approximately 3–6% per year, supported by ongoing infrastructure development and limited supply in premium segments. Rental yields for high-end properties typically range from 4–6% gross annually, depending on location and unit size. With the right positioning, this property could generate a combined annual return of up to 8–10% before costs, making it an attractive option for long-term investors seeking both income and value growth.

Are there pros/cons of buying a condo on Thong Lo vs Ekkamai? Or are they similar?

While close to each other, Thonglor is more developed and has numerous shops, bars and restaurants. It is a more "desirable" neighbourhood and in demand. It will attract higher prices for both rent and sale. Ekkamai is a developing area, and will eventually catch up to Thonglor. So, if you like trendy areas, Tonglor will be your more expensive option, if you prefer to stretch your budget a little further, Ekkamai is a good option with a strong potential to increase in value.
